👑 Classic Nicknames for Elizabeth

Classic Nicknames for Elizabeth

Elizabeth is one of the most regal names in history, so it’s no surprise that the classic nicknames remain timeless favorites.

Quick Picks: Liz, Lizzy, Beth, Bess, Ellie

  • Liz
    A short, chic version of Elizabeth, often used for its simplicity and elegance.
  • Lizzy
    A playful, youthful nickname that adds warmth and friendliness.
  • Beth
    A softer and more traditional form, often associated with kindness.
  • Bess
    A vintage-style nickname once popular among royals and nobles.
  • Eliza
    A strong, historical variation with literary charm.
  • Ella
    A sweet, short option that feels modern and musical.
  • Liza
    Pronounced Lie-za, a glamorous nickname popularized by celebrities.
  • Betty
    Classic and retro, famously tied to cultural icons like Betty White.
  • Libby
    Cute and quirky, often chosen for its originality.
  • Elsa
    A stylish nickname that gained modern fame through Disney’s Frozen.

📚 Literary & Historical Nicknames for Elizabeth

Literary & Historical Nicknames for Elizabeth

Because Elizabeth has appeared in literature and history, here are some nicknames inspired by famous figures.

Quick Picks: Eliza (Pride & Prejudice), Lizzy Bennet, Queen Bess, Lilibet, Ella

  • Lizzy Bennet
    Inspired by the heroine of Pride and Prejudice.
  • Eliza
    A strong literary variation.
  • Queen Bess
    A title used for Queen Elizabeth I.
  • Lilibet
    Queen Elizabeth II’s childhood nickname.
  • Ella
    Literary, sweet, and poetic.
  • Bess Tudor
    Historical nod to Elizabeth Tudor.
  • Liz White
    Inspired by historical figures named Elizabeth.
  • Beth March
    From Little Women, symbolizing kindness.
  • Isabel
    A Spanish variation historically tied to queens.
  • Elsa
    Modern pop culture with literary vibes.

❓ FAQs About Nicknames for Elizabeth

1. What are the most popular nicknames for Elizabeth?
Liz, Lizzy, Beth, Ellie, and Eliza are among the most common.

2. What is Queen Elizabeth’s nickname?
Her family famously called her Lilibet.

3. Are there cute nicknames for Elizabeth?
Yes—Ellie, Lizzie-Bee, Lulu, and Bella are especially cute options.

4. Can Elizabeth be shortened to Ella?
Yes, Ella is a lovely and simple modern short form.

5. What are some funny nicknames for Elizabeth?
Lizard, Lizzilla, and Busy Lizzy are playful favorites.

6. Is Isabel related to Elizabeth?
Yes, Isabel is a variation of Elizabeth used in Spanish and Portuguese.

7. What are unique nicknames for Elizabeth?
Lilibet, Zibby, Ibby, and Elara are standout unique choices.
